If you have the high-quality PDF, pay special attention to Chapter 8. This is the heart. Hitherto, you have studied probability (deduction: from population to sample). Now, you begin statistics (induction: from sample to population).

The joy is in the pivot. You learn about the distribution of the sample mean, the chi-square distribution of the sample variance, and the t-distribution of a standardized mean. Seeing how the normal, chi-square, t, and F distributions all relate to one another is like watching a family reunion of mathematical ideas. It is simple, elegant, and infinitely generative.
